Five Blackwater Guards Surrender

Fresno, CA The guards were indicted for killing 17 Iraqi civilians, in Baghdad, two years ago. The Justice Department charged the men with manslaughter, attempted manslaughter, and using a machine gun in a crime of violence.

By surrendering in Utah, the guards can argue the trial should be held there, not in Washington D.C., were they were charged.

Also on Monday, a sixth guard admitted in a plea deal to killing at least one Iraqi in the shooting. Blackwater is the largest U.S. security contractor in Iraq.
